What will it take for this weary warrior to redeem his lonely soul?
Bear shifter Soren Voss lives and breathes for the new clan he leads as alpha. It’s all he has left after the rogue ambush that murdered the woman he loved — the woman he swears he’ll always love, even if it’s only in his dreams. But the day his dream comes true is also the start of a nightmare, because his destined mate may no longer be his and his alone. Is it fate’s way of torturing him or his last chance at redemption?

Sarah Boone narrowly escaped the inferno that claimed her family and her home. For months now, she’s been on the run with a secret that will soon be impossible to hide. But the clock is ticking, and she needs a place to settle down soon. She never expected to find the love of her life running a funky little place called the Blue Moon Saloon. He’s darker and more dangerous than ever, but somehow more vulnerable, too. Does she have it in her to be the woman her world-weary warrior needs most of all?

Behind the doors of the Blue Moon Saloon, alpha shifters confront their darkest fears and their deepest desires. Each book is a complete standalone story — no cliffhangers!

* A paranormal romance with adult content. The perfect read for fans of strong heroines, alpha heroes, werewolves and shapeshifters, red-hot cowboys, romantic westerns, paranormal suspense, action-adventure romance, and fantasy romance! *

The Blue Moon Saloon spin-off from the Wolves of Twin Moon Ranch series is a hit on its own. This standalone addition to the series tells the story of Soren Voss, grizzly bear shifter and clan alpha. He and his brother Simon were out of state when a rogue wolf pack destroyed their birth clan and family. Most of a nearby wolf pack was also annihilated, along with a family that lived on the edge of town, operating a trading post. Included was their daughter, Sarah Boone, Sorren's unclaimed mate. Sorren and Simon tracked and killed the wolves responsible for the carnage. Then, exhausted, they settled in Twin Moon wolf pack territory, leasing and operating the Blue Moon Saloon from the pack. Soren is resigned to a life lived without his mate, until the impossible happens and she walks back into his life. He is stunned, happy she survived, but devastated that she is obviously no longer his, in spite of what his bear says. It will take time for them to come to terms with the realities of their pasts, time they may not have with the purist extremist rogues still on the hunt.

This book, the third in the series brings completion to Soren's story. Sorin and his brother Simon both moved to The Blue Moon Saloon after their whole clan/family were murdered, burned alive, by The Bluebloods a group of fanatical killers determined to stop shifters mating outside their own species. But Sorin didn't only lose his family he lost Sarah, the human, who was his Destined Mate.

Many months later Sorin gets his second chance at love and happiness when Sarah gets off the bus just outside the Blue Moon, she's thin, she's frightened, she has scars after trying to save her parents from the fire which killed them. Sorin is both shocked and elated to see her alive but then he notices something which could change everything - Sarah is pregnant and there is no way the baby could be his!

I really felt for Sorin his elation at seeing Sarah alive, his hurt at the thought of his mate choosing another man over him, his need to help her and the baby whilst trying to remain strong, for himself and his clan/pack. Over time we find out what happened in Montana. We watch as Sarah and Sorin build new bonds as she is welcomed into their little community, working in the cafe run by Janna and Jessica (Damnation and Temptation) and helping Sorin too.

But their peaceful life is threatened again, by The Blue Bloods lead by Victor White. I was on the edge of my seat as both Sarah and Sorin fight for their very lives and their future.
